烟箱条码检测系统环形扫码装置的研制
2016-11-28李用清吴文韬
李用清,吴文韬
(广西中烟工业有限责任公司柳州卷烟厂,广西柳州545006)
烟箱条码检测系统环形扫码装置的研制
李用清,吴文韬
(广西中烟工业有限责任公司柳州卷烟厂,广西柳州545006)
为保证出库质量,防止混烟发生,研制一种烟箱条码检测系统环形扫码装置,安装在卷烟出库的伸缩皮带机上,具备同时扫描一号工程条码和烟箱条码,并与系统中预先设定的出库卷烟规格进行对比,如果全部一致则予以放行,如果不一致则声光报警并停止成品出库伸缩皮带机,在人工处置确认后再予以放行,确保出库卷烟规格、烟箱所装条烟与一号工程码品牌规格全部匹配。本装置可避免出库混烟发生,防止出错烟,保证卷烟成品出库质量,减少市场退烟。
环形扫码装置;条码检测系统;一号工程码
国家烟草局为进一步规范卷烟条码的使用,保证卷烟生产、销售信息统计的准确性,制定了《卷烟条码使用规则》。国内生产卷烟的箱包装、条盒包装和小盒包装都必须印刷(或粘贴等)符合要求的条码标识,并满足唯一性、稳定性和可识别性要求。行业卷烟生产经营决策管理系统简称为“一号工程”,主要通过对件烟和条烟进行唯一标识,在封箱机完成封箱后,有专门的打码贴码设备,给纸箱正面贴一个32位的128码,并在关键物流业务环节对标识进行识别,实现卷烟产品从工业生产到商业销售全过程物流跟踪,从而实时采集工业产销存、商业进销存的物流数据[1]。
卷烟烟箱条码是唯一的,但是烟箱条码所在位置没有硬性规定,不同卷烟规格的烟箱条码所在位置也不同,一般在正面位置,一些烟箱条码则在侧面和背面[2]。近期市场反馈,卷烟一号工程条码所标品牌与烟箱存在不匹配现象,经过追溯分析发现:烟箱与烟箱内条烟品牌、型号一致,但是与一号工程条码所标识品牌、规格不一致,主要原因是机器打码或人工贴码过程中发生烟箱包装与一号工程码标识错误,出库扫码时只扫描一号工程码,未能及时排除因贴码错误而造成的混烟情况。为解决这一隐患,根据生产需要研制一个扫码装置在出库时对烟箱条码、一号工程条码进行扫描并与出库规格卷烟条码进行比对,剔除混烟,防止出错烟,保证卷烟成品出库质量。
1 烟箱条码检测系统环形扫码装置功能需求
烟箱条码信息检测装置主要功能需求如下:扫描卷烟烟箱条码与一号工程条码,取其中品牌码段与操作人员在条码检测工控机界面上预先设置的品牌条码进行对比,对比结果合格的卷烟烟箱予以放行,不合格的则发出警报并停止出库伸缩皮带机。扫描卷烟烟箱条码与一号工程条码时需考虑到由于烟箱在传送带上的方向不一致,条码有可能会在烟箱的上、下、左、右四个面,为了保证扫描到所有卷烟烟箱条码,需从四个方向全方位扫描,不管条码在烟箱的哪一面,都保证能准确无误的扫到烟箱条码和一号工程条码。
2 烟箱条码检测系统构成
烟箱条码检测系统环形扫码装置将卷烟烟箱上的条码和一号工程码扫描下来并传输到工控机与设定的出库卷烟规格进行对比,将信息进行处理之后判断是否予以放行出库,保证出库时没有混烟情况[3]。烟箱条码检测系统分为软件、硬件两大部分。
2.1 硬件部分
硬件部分主要由工业计算机、条形码扫描头、扫描头连接模块、光电开关以及单片机控制器等组成。扫码头是德国SICK公司生产的带自动聚焦功能的固定式多扫描线型条码扫描器,条码扫描器的连接模块包含电源模块、通讯接口和状态指示电路,光电开关连接到连接模块的输入端子上作为扫码头的出发开关。单片机控制器的功能在于和计算机实时通讯,假如在系统运行过程中发生错箱错牌等情况,计算机会发出相应的指令,单片机接收到指令后,会停止传送带并发出报警提示操作人员及时处理。扫码器和单片连接模块通过串行接口和工业计算机连接。硬件结构如图1所示。
图1 烟箱条码检测系统硬件组成
2.2 软件部分
烟箱条码检测系统软件的核心功能是条码比对,其判断依据是装箱机开机前操作人员在条码检测工控机界面上预先设置的品牌,通过将扫描到的一号工程码、烟箱条码与预设的品牌进行对比,如果三者的品牌特征码一致,则判断为“合格”,如果有不一致的情况,则判断为“不合格”。
2.2.1 软件设计总体思路
(1)根据烟箱条码检测系统整个运行步骤及要实现的功能,据此设计出主窗口的界面,运用C++图形用户界面应用程序框架的知识对界面的控件布局,包括按钮中图片的插入、空的标签中显示一个动态图并由按钮控制其运行状态。
(2)运用C++图形用户界面应用程序框架编写串口,由一号工程码和烟箱条码的标志位分析并掌握串口数据的读取和判断,包括未扫到一号工程码、未扫到烟箱条码、未扫到条码、一号工程码不匹配、烟箱条码不匹配、条码都不匹配,条码匹配等。
(3)数据库的研究设计,准备数据源,创建两张表格,一张显示正常数据的存取记录,一张显示异常情况的发生,即异常报告,并设计当管理员添加新用户时密码在数据库的显示为lain格式,保证管理员的密码和用户的密码安全。
(4)逐步设计每个功能,如查询功能,为了使用户操作方便,加入日历表,可对时间进行快速、准确的操作。设置窗口的大小比例,控件按钮的位置,并设计导出和清除功能。
综合分析卷包车间提出的使用需求和实际工况,得出如图2所示系统控制流程图。
图2 系统控制流程图
2.2.2 烟箱条码检测系统功能模块
烟箱条码检测系统主要功能模块包括:品牌管理、参数设置、身份认证、用户管理、异常记录、历史数据导出功能、统计分析等。品牌管理主要对出库的烟箱品牌进行录入、选择、删除等;参数设置包括设置班次时间,调整品牌码长度,切换系统工作模式(是否忽略烟箱条码)及机台信息;身份认证和用户管理主要对系统操作人员账号进行管理及授权;异常记录主要记录系统运行过程中出现的异常事件,包括未扫描到一号工程码,未扫描到烟箱条码,扫描到的条码不一致等,并支持包括卷烟品牌名称,班次,日期、异常等多种查询条件过滤,在自动导出模式下,导出后历史数据以减轻数据库负担;统计分析通过实时统计扫描,对班次、机台、品牌名、品牌码,品牌码位数、是否忽略烟箱码、正常扫码件烟数量、未扫到条码件烟数量和条码不匹配件烟数量统计分析。
3 运行效果检验
烟箱条码检测系统环形扫码装置按照设计组装完成后如图3所示,其检测系统操作界面如图4所示。烟箱条码检测系统环形扫码装置研制完成后,在柳州卷烟厂卷烟成品出库输送伸缩皮带机上面进行了效果检验,通过测试,该装置对混进的其它规格卷烟烟箱剔除率为100%,可避免成品出库混烟发生,防止出错烟,保证了卷烟成品出库质量,减少市场退烟。目前柳州卷烟厂三个卷烟出库口均已使用该装置,设备运行正常,检测功能效果显著,达到了设计预期效果。
图3 烟箱条码检测系统环形扫码装置实物图
图4 检测系统操作界面
[1]张旭江.卷烟行业成品烟箱的牌号识别与统计系统[J].中国新技术新产品,2014,(2):12-13.
[2]钟志锋.条码检测在成品烟箱错牌中的应用[J].城市建设理论研究电子版,2013,(17):14-15.
[3]瞿德智.条码技术在成品烟箱长距离传输中的应用[C].//广西烟草学会学术年会,2008.
Development of Ring Scanning Device for Cigarette Box Code Detection System
LI Yong-qing,WU Wen-tao
(Guangxi Tobacco Industry Co.,Ltd. Liuzhou Cigarette Factory,Liuzhou Guangxi 545006,China)
In order to ensure the quality of library to prevent mixed cigarette occurrence,development of a cigarette box code detection system circular scan code device,installed on the cigarette out of the library of telescopic belt conveyor,with scanning at the same time,engineering barcode and cigarette box code and system in the preset library cigarette specifications and compared,if all the agreement,to be released;if the inconsistency of sound and light alarm and stop the finished goods warehouse telescopic belt conveyor,after manual handling confirmation again to be released,ensure outbound cigarette size,a cigarette box installed a cigarette and a project code brand specifications all matching. The device can avoid the occurrence of a warehouse,prevent the cigarette from the cigarette,guarantee the quality of the finished product of the cigarette,and reduce the cigarette out of the market.
ring scanning code device;bar code detection system;one project code.
P274.5献标识码:A
1672-545X(2016)09-0103-03
2016-06-17
李用清(1978-),男,广西桂林,本科,工程师,主要研究电气设备与信息技术应用。